Board Siding Replacement in Boston, MA
Board siding replacement services involve removing damaged or aging exterior siding boards and installing new ones to restore the appearance and integrity of a property’s exterior. This service covers a variety of projects, including replacing rotted or warped boards, upgrading to more durable materials, or updating the style of the siding to improve curb appeal. Property owners typically seek this service when their current siding shows signs of deterioration, such as cracking, splitting, or water damage, or when they want to enhance the overall look and protection of their home.
Before requesting board siding replacement, homeowners should consider the type of siding material they prefer, such as wood, fiber cement, or composite boards, and understand the scope of the project in terms of the number of boards to be replaced. It’s also useful to know the condition of the underlying structure, as replacement may involve repairs to ensure proper support and sealing against the elements. Clarifying these details can help ensure the project aligns with the property’s needs and aesthetic goals.

Board Siding Replacement Questions
What are signs that board siding needs replacement? Visible warping, cracking, or rotting boards indicate the need for replacement to maintain siding integrity.
Can board siding be replaced without removing the entire section? Yes, damaged boards can often be replaced individually, preserving existing siding where possible.
Is it necessary to upgrade to a different siding material during replacement? Not necessarily; replacing with the same material is common, but options can be discussed based on durability and appearance.
What should homeowners consider before replacing board siding? Factors include siding condition, material compatibility, and the overall style of the property to ensure a suitable match.
